Alex Wilkinson, Founder & Principal

Picture
My first experience in public service was organizing students from Minnesota to live with black families in rural Georgia, helping them register to vote during the summer when the Voting Rights Act was passed. I learned much about the ravages of poverty, the burdens of discrimination, human resilience - and myself - during that memorable summer.

Since then, learning and doing have energized my career.  I earned a PhD in human development with emphasis on statistical modeling, taught for a decade on University faculties, was awarded patents as a software engineer, and worked extensively as a volunteer, employee, and consultant for non-profits in human services and education.

Along the way, I have seen how poorly many non-profits and educational institutions support financial planning for their employees. Using my statistical training, psychology degree, and software expertise, I've analyzed market data from 1871 and used research on human decision-making to develop apps for able2pay.com. I am an avid reader of academic work on financial planning and economics, and continue to give back to under-served communities with pro bono work in education and legal services.

Background

Public Charities
  • Director of Information Technology for a national 501(c)(3) charity promoting career readiness in underserved high schools.
  • Director of Client Services at a startup software company supporting foundations and non-profit social services.
  • Program Manager for a 501(c)(3) charity offering consulting and software applications to foundations and other charities.
University Educator
  • Professor of Practice, i-School at Syracuse University, teaching technology, innovation, and information privacy.
  • Assistant Professor, University of Wisconsin - Madison, doing research and education in psychology and statistics.
Expertise
  • Proficiency in ESPlanner supplemented by proprietary analysis of market data since 1871.
  • Twenty years as software engineer and technical manager at AT&T and Bell Laboratories. Current proficiency in multiple software applications and databases, including Quick Base, Podio, Salesforce.com, Nationbuilder, Google Apps, Office365, Active Directory, Box, Okta, file-sharing, websites, Javascript, financial models, and more.
